The Effects Of Performance Feedback On Exercise, Physiological Reactivity, And Affective State Among Hostile College Students, Crystal Chia-Sheng Lin May 2002

The Effects Of Performance Feedback On Exercise, Physiological Reactivity, And Affective State Among Hostile College Students, Crystal Chia-Sheng Lin

All Graduate Theses and Dissertations, Spring 1920 to Summer 2023

Hostility has been found to be a risk factor for cardiovascular disease. One proposed pathway between hostility and cardiovascular disease is an increase in cardiovascular reactivity among hostile individuals when faced with challenging, competitive situations, in which interpersonal stressors are present. A potential situation that may elicit this exaggerated reactivity is found in cardiac rehabilitation exercise programs. Such factors may be competition and feedback regarding their performance. This study sought to find out how hostile individuals would respond physiologically, behaviorally, and affectively when presented with negative and positive performance feedback, while exercising in a challenging, competitive setting. An Investigation Of The Prevalence And Nature Of Child Sexual Abuse Among The Deaf Population, Rachelle Hester May 2002

An Investigation Of The Prevalence And Nature Of Child Sexual Abuse Among The Deaf Population, Rachelle Hester

All Graduate Theses and Dissertations, Spring 1920 to Summer 2023

The purpose of this study was to investigate the prevalence rates and effects of child sexual abuse in both deaf and hearing individuals living in Utah. A total of 104 deaf and 69 hearing individuals responded to the survey. The survey inquired about participants' experiences with sexual abuse and their mental health status.

The difference in rates of abuse between the two groups was not statistically significant. However, deaf individuals tended to be abused more often than hearing individuals. Prehistoric Uinta Mountain Occupations, U.S. Forest Service, Clay Johnson, Byron Loosle Feb 2002

Prehistoric Uinta Mountain Occupations, U.S. Forest Service, Clay Johnson, Byron Loosle

All U.S. Government Documents (Utah Regional Depository)

Examines a number of sites revealing how people from a particular period utilized different uplands resources, elevation, and settings as they made the transition to a more sedentary life-way. These Uinta Mountains sites represent hitherto little know portions of regional settlement and subsistence patterns, and complement the more extensive published research on lowland occupations


The Ideological Development Of U.S. Government Publication, 1820-1920: From Jefferson To Croly, John Walters Feb 2002

The Ideological Development Of U.S. Government Publication, 1820-1920: From Jefferson To Croly, John Walters

John Walters

Abstract-This paper traces the development of an ideology for U.S. government publication, focusing primarily on dominant strands of political thought during the antebellum period, the gilded age, and the progressive era. This paper examines political thought that inhibited the development of an ideology of U.S. government publication, such as the antistatism of Thomas Jefferson and the Social Darwinism of Herbert Spencer and William Graham Sumner; it focuses also on American political thought that fostered its development, such as the Positivism of Lester Frank Ward, the Pragmatism of John Dewey, and the Progressivism of Herbert Croly
